The Historical Development of the Sa'adatuddarain Educational Foundation in Mampang Prapatan: A Historical Study of Its Origins, Development, and Contributions to Education and Society
Abstrak
This study examines the historical development of the Sa'adatuddarain Educational Foundation, an Islamic educational institution in Mampang Prapatan, South Jakarta, that has operated for more than six decades. Using a qualitative historical approach, the research applies heuristics, source criticism, interpretation, and historiography to institutional documents, official education data, interviews, media reports, and scholarly literature. The findings show that four religious scholars and community leaders established the foundation in the 1960s. It subsequently developed from a religious elementary institution into an integrated educational system extending from kindergarten to Islamic senior high school. Enrollment grew from approximately 1,400 students in 2011/2012 to 2,000 in 2019, while its alumni exceeded 10,000. The foundation also supports orphans and disadvantaged communities, distributes sacrificial meat, and collaborates with government institutions on teacher assistance programs. Its continuity reflects effective family-based leadership succession, scholarly networks, institutional adaptability, sustained religious commitment, and enduring concern for community welfare and education.
